How about if you had a goal from the beginning of the game, single player or server, to build a city with everything from trains and planes to electricity and factories. In the current game, you have to mine everything and build at a basic level, but my idea to make it better would be that you could build factories to produce certain items, and you would have to experiment to invent better technology to better your society. This could work with the NPCs, as you build more, they show up and help you. You could assign each one a specific job, house, and keeping them happy could be a goal. like, you are their leader and they will follow you to the ends of the earth, as long as you give them rest and access to food. The eventual goal is to build a working society of your NPCs. Maybe add in vehicles, and if you get enough resources and get far enough in development of your society you could maybe build a rocket and fly to the moon you see in the sky every night. This could lead to having servers with a couple friends that leads to space races and such. This is my first suggestion so let me know what you guys think.

Industrial Craft and Redpower mods are simular to what your suggesting. They provide a means for automated production that in turn allows for more futuristic devices or inventions to be created.
But I think in order for this idea to be fully realized, we would have to first broaden the game as it is, adding more minerals such as copper and tin (as Industrial Craft does).
So good idea, but I think we should focus our support for laying the ground work that will allow for content as broad and bold as you are suggesting.
